Understanding Short Term Drug Rehab in Tusculum, Tennessee

Short term drug treatment is one of the more successful types of substance abuse treatment. In particular, it can prove appropriate for individuals in Tusculum who cannot participate in a long-term rehab program.

Although, there are numerous things you need to consider while selecting the treatment center you are going to attend. The three main factors include cost, success rates/effectiveness, and time.

Because no universal recovery plan will work for all addicts, you will have a few options to decide on depending on your particular needs and desires. Among these options is short term drug and alcohol treatment.

In many cases, short term rehabilitation will have you live within the treatment facility for a few weeks. These facilities are similar to long-term addiction treatment but they last much shorter yet at the same time ensuring that you receive the support, attention, and monitoring that will guarantee you stay sober.

Specifically, short term treatment will range in duration from 2 - 6 weeks. During this time, you may benefit from individual and group counseling and therapy even as you continue learning effective life skills that will empower you to effectively handle any problematic situation you may run into as opposed to reaching for drugs or alcohol.

Typically, short term rehab in Tusculum, TN. will begin with medical detox. The length of this program will largely depend on the dose and frequency of your drug or alcohol use as well as the length of time you have been using.

After you complete detoxification, the short term rehab center will perform other methods of treatment depending on your specific requirements and preferences. For instance, treatment might use the 12 step method to allow you to take advantage of peer support. These treatment components may help hold you accountable as you work through your addiction.

Other treatment approaches that may be available through short term rehab include:

  • Art therapy
  • Acupuncture
  • Group counseling
  • Cognitive behavioral therapy
  • Individual counseling
  • Nature therapy
  • Medication
  • Yoga
  • Treatment for co-occurring mental health conditions like anxiety and depression

These treatment methods may be provided to help modify your behavior, prevent you from drug use, and teach you how to make healthier decisions so that you do not relapse. You may also learn helpful coping strategies and improve your relaxation, so you don't feel you have to use drugs.
